4 a storage of energy Proteins are large macromolecule which consist of small amino acid which are linked together by peptide bond Main storage form of energy in the body is carbobhydrate The body uses energy from carbohydrate if there is immediate requirement Energy from protein is taken if there is a long starvation The primary function of protein include building of muscle and bone synthesis of hormones enzymes    See Answer
